Introduction

This Policy explains how we collect, use, disclose, and safeguard information when you use the One World Conference mobile app (the “App”) for viewing the agenda, session details, receiving announcements, scanning QR badges and participating in live surveys/Q&A.

1. Information we collect

1.1 Information you provide

    • Identity & contact (name, email, company/role); optional profile photo/bio.
    • Preferences (favorites, saved sessions).
    • Survey & Q&A inputs: ratings, votes, free‑text questions/comments; you may post with your name or anonymously (depending on the survey setting).
       

1.2 Information collected automatically

    • Device/usage (device/OS, app version, IP, diagnostics, crash logs).
    • Notification token to deliver push alerts for schedule and room changes.

 

1.3 From third parties

Registration/Check‑in data from our event platform/vendor (e.g., PheedLoop): ticket/registration ID, badge/QR code, and check‑in status to enable access and seating/flow management.

2. QR scanning & attendance

2.1 When you scan your badge/QR at entrances or sessions, we collect:

Registration/ticket ID, name, company, timestamp, and location context.
We use this to:

    • Validate access, manage capacity, reduce wait times, and support operational safety;
    • Generate attendance analytics and session popularity insights;
    • (Where applicable) send relevant follow‑ups (e.g., “slides now available”).

 

We do not use QR scans for tracking outside the event context or for third‑party advertising.

3. How we use information

We use your information to provide the App’s core features (agenda, announcements, QR check‑in, surveys/Q&A), to operate and secure the App (including analytics, diagnostics and performance monitoring), to respond to your inquiries and service requests, and to comply with legal obligations and enforce our terms. Where permitted, we may send event‑related communications; any promotional messages involving sponsors will be sent only with your consent or as allowed by law. These purposes reflect MTech’s standard privacy framework for apps and websites.

4. How we share information

We share information with service providers acting as processors that support the event stack—such as the registration and on‑site check‑in platform (e.g., PheedLoop), cloud hosting, analytics and push notification services—under contracts that restrict their use of the data to our instructions. We may also share limited information within the Munters/MTech group for event operations, with the venue or security teams for access control and safety, and with authorities when required by law. Sponsors will only receive your identifiable information where you have opted in or where otherwise permitted by law.

5. Security

We apply administrative, technical and physical safeguards designed to protect personal information against unauthorized access, use or disclosure. No method of transmission or storage is completely secure; we continuously review and enhance our controls in line with corporate standards

6. App Store/Play disclosures

“Data linked to you” may include contact details, registration ID, attendance records, and app activity (e.g., favorites), along with device identifiers and diagnostics. Aggregated analytics and diagnostics may be processed but are not linked to your identity. We do not track you across other apps or websites for third‑party advertising; if this changes, we will update this Policy and seek consent where required.
